all'esame (tra 1 settimana ) devo portare di teoria anke qst parte: variabili locali e globali, cioè validità e visibilità


dal libro: "In generale una variabile è sempre visibile all'interno del suo campo di validità. Dicesi locale una variabile la cui validità resta circoscritta a quell'ambiente;
globale una variabile comune a più ambienti.
codice:
//e fin qui ci siamo  :)
Nelle variabili vann distinti 2 differenti cicli di vita: quello dele variabili statiche e quello delle variabili dinamiche
codice:
//quelle statiche sono semplicissime ma le altre...
La tecnica di allocazione dinamica implicita è legata al meccanismo di chiamata e ritorno di un sottoprogramma e/o a quello di entrata ed uscita da un blocco.
In ogni caso le variabili locali all'ambiente in esame sono istanziate, cioè allocate all'atto dell'entrata nell'ambiente e deallocate all'uscita. Poichè la disciplina di entrata è tipicamente LIFO si può adoperare una tecnica a
stack: all'atto dell'istanzione si preleva l'area necessaria da uno stack, al quale la si restituisce alla deallocazione."


NON CI HO CAPITO UNA MAZZA!! KE VUOLE?KE DICE?KE HO FATTO DI MALE??
aiutoooooooooooooo ho l'esameeeeeeee!!!!